1. A television (TV) broadcasting signal transmitting apparatus for transmitting layer1-detail (L1D) signaling information for TV broadcasting, the TV broadcasting transmitting apparatus being operable in a mode among a plurality of modes, the TV broadcasting transmitting apparatus comprising:

  • a zero padder configured to receive L1D input bits to be encoded and modulated, fill a bit space of a predetermined size with the L1D input bits and one or more zero padding bits based on a zero padding order of the mode, if a size of the L1D input bits is less than the predetermined size, wherein the L1D input bits are based on the L1D signaling information;

    an encoder configured to encode bits included in the bit space based on a low density parity check (LDPC) code having a code rate of the mode being 3/15 and a code length of the mode being 16200 bits;

    a zero remover configured to remove the one or more zero padding bits from among the encoded bits included in the bit space;

    a mapper configured to modulate bits, included in the bit space remaining after the removing, to constellation points based on a quadrature phase shift keying (QPSK) modulation of the mode;

    a signal generator configured to generate a TV broadcasting signal based on the constellation points using orthogonal frequency division (OFDM) processing; and

    a transmitter configured to transmit the TV broadcasting signal,wherein the zero padder is configured to fill the bit space of the predetermined size by dividing the bit space into a plurality of bit group areas, calculating a number of zero padding bits to be padded, determining at least one bit group area to which the one or more zero padding bits are padded among the plurality of bit group areas based on the calculated number and the zero padding order of the mode and padding the one or more zero padding bits to the at least one bit group area, andwherein the zero padding order of the mode is represented below;
